University of Scranton vs. Villanova University

Compare two schools with tuition, admission, test scores, and more academic characteristics.

  • Both University of Scranton and Villanova University are private.
  • Both schools are located in Pennsylvania.
  • Villanova University has more expensive tuition of $64,701 than University of Scranton ($52,309).
  • Villanova University has tighter acceptance rate of 36.00% than University of Scranton (74.79%).
  • Villanova University has higher SAT scores of 1,440 than University of Scranton (1,230).
  • Villanova University is larger with 10,383 students than University of Scranton (4,731 students).
